Guignier is committed to producing wines in the most natural way possible in order to both protect the environment and create wines that are alive and transmit a sense of place. He is in the process of slowly converting his estate to full organic certification, though has been composting and sowing grasses, herbs and wild flowers between rows for many years. Grape: Gamay, fruit coming primarily from Morgon
Viticulture: Organic, in the process of certification
Soil: Decomposed granite and crumbly schist
